Abstract

We investigate the second-order nonlinear interaction as a means to generate entanglement between fields of differing wavelengths and show that perfect entanglement can, in principle, be produced between the fundamental and second-harmonic fields in these processes. Neither pure second-harmonic generation nor parametric oscillation optimally produce entanglement; such optimal entanglement is rather produced by an intermediate process.
